About The Position

The Wheaton Archives & Special Collections invites undergraduate and graduate students to apply for the Archival Clerk position. Archival Clerks support the mission of the Archives & Special Collections by contributing to processing, preservation, and digitization projects, and providing prompt access to archival materials requested by users. Qualified candidates should be flexible, enthusiastic, detail-orientated, and able work independently. Archival Clerks will be required to maintain the confidentiality of restricted archival materials and be able to lift boxes of up to 40 pounds. The position is 10 hours/week for the 2026/2027 academic year and reports to a designated Archives & Special Collections staff member. This position is not eligible for Federal Work Study.

Responsibilities

  • Paging and refiling archival materials for researcher use in the Manuscripts Reading Room.
  • Assisting with archival processing projects, including sorting, arranging, and describing archival materials.
  • Transcribing oral history interviews.
  • Contributing to digitization efforts, including photographs, sound and moving image recordings.
  • Perform light office duties, including dusting and cleaning storage spaces, running campus errands to Bookstore, CPO, Student Services, etc.
  • Assist with accessioning new collections, including unloading and inventorying shipments of archival materials.
  • Other duties and special projects as assigned.
